The three-door version of the Evoque can only be purchased in its range topping Dynamic trim level and fitted with the 240 hp 2.0-liter gasoline engine. As for the five-door, that will be sold in all three trim levels, Pure, Prestige and Dynamic, and with the 2.2-liter 190 hp turbodiesel.
Standard features on all Evoques will come to include Terrain Response, a fixed panoramic glass roof, Xenon headlamps, 17-inch wheels, keyless start, climate control, electric adjust front seats in leather, 8-inch touch screen, Bluetooth connectivity with audio streaming and an 11-speaker Meridian audio system.
